Will you be moving into somewhere with a lot of green space if you moved to Avonwick?

Green space is a vital element that is often compromised in different locations, hindering its availability. For instance, urban areas frequently fall short of the recommended benchmark of 6 acres of green space per thousand people. In Avonwick, the available data reveals that there are 17.1 acres of green space per thousand residents. For health reasons, there should be 6 acres.

In Avonwick, what does the property sales data look like based on Rightmove?

Average sold prices of properties on Rightmove

In the area of Avonwick in the UK, the average sold price of a property is around £294,164. This is based on the average of all of the types of property listed on Rightmove and other listing platforms. Take a look below to see how this average is made up:

Type of property Average sold price
detached house £367,840
Semi detached house £248,595
Terraced house £228,093

Is it important to look at yield in Avonwick in further detail?

Avonwick averages at no relevant data for this city for rental yield and this should be looked at in comparison with the average for the UK which tends to fluctuate around 4.4%. Having said this, rental yields can drop as low as 1% in the central areas of London and rise to as high as 9% in areas with high rental demand such as Stoke.
Yield, which is no relevant data for this city in Avonwick, is worked out by dividing the net rental income of a property by the purchase price.
